比特币钱包中的多重签名:提升安全性的关键技
引言
在加密货币的世界中,安全性始终是一个重中之重的话题。比特币作为第一个出现的加密货币,其钱包的安全性对于用户来说至关重要。多重签名(Multi-Signature,简称为Multisig)技术的引入,使得比特币钱包在安全性上更进一步。通过要求多个密钥的签名才能进行交易,多重签名有效地降低了单一账户被攻击的风险,从而为用户提供了一种更加安全的方式来管理他们的虚拟资产。
1. 什么是比特币多重签名?
多重签名是一种加密技术,它要求多把私钥才能批准和执行一笔交易。具体来说,Multisig 钱包会生成一组公钥,每一个公钥都有一个对应的私钥。用户可以设置该钱包的规则,比如说“三个密钥中的两个密钥才能完成交易”。这种设计使得攻击者不能仅仅依靠盗取一个私钥就能完成交易,这样大大增强了资金的安全性。
2. 多重签名的工作原理
多重签名钱包的工作原理涉及几个步骤。首先,创建钱包时,用户会生成一组公钥和私钥。之后,这些公钥会被组合成一个新的地址。在执行交易时,系统会要求特定数量的私钥签名。比如,在3/5的设置中,用户需要5个私钥中的3个进行签名才能验证这笔交易。
这样的设置不仅提高了安全性,还能够用于公司或团队的多方决策。只有在确保了多方同意的情况下,资金才能被移动。这在企业级的环境下尤为重要。
3. 为什么使用多重签名技术?
使用多重签名技术的理由主要可以归结为以下几点:
- 提升安全性:单个私钥的丢失或被盗可能导致资金的全部损失,而多重签名要求多个密钥的参与,从而显著降低了这种风险。
- 更好的资金管理:在团队或组织中,多重签名钱包能够确保资金不会被无意间使用,只有在团队达成共识时才能进行操作。
- 防止内部欺诈:在公司管理资金时,各个部门的负责人可以各自拥有一个私钥,确保任何资金调动都有合理的审批流程。
4. 如何设置比特币多重签名钱包?
设置一个多重签名钱包相对简单,但过程需要一些技术知识。以下是设置步骤:
- 选择支持多重签名的钱包:选择一个支持多重签名功能的钱包软件或硬件钱包。
- 生成公钥和私钥:根据您的需求生成需要的公钥和私钥。
- 配置多重签名规则:设置个人的多重签名模式,比如2/3或3/5,并记录下相关的私钥。
- 测试交易:在进行实际交易前,可以进行小额测试,确保设置的有效性和安全性。
5. 比特币多重签名钱包的适用场景
多重签名钱包适用的场景非常广泛,下面列举了一些主要应用:
- 个人资产保护:对比特币资产持有者而言,使用多重签名钱包可保障资产安全,防止单点故障。
- 企业财务管理:企业使用多重签名钱包可有效管理和监控财务,防止滥用。
- 慈善机构和组织:慈善机构需要确保每一笔资金的使用都有合理的监督,多重签名的引入能够帮助其管理资金。
6. 可能相关的问题
在讨论比特币钱包中的多重签名时,许多人可能会提出以下
- 多重签名的钱包如何与普通钱包不同?
- 多重签名技术的潜在风险是什么?
- 如何选择合适的多重签名钱包?
- 未来多重签名技术的发展趋势是什么?
7. 多重签名钱包如何与普通钱包不同?
多重签名钱包和普通钱包的主要区别在于安全性和操作流程。普通钱包通常仅依赖单一私钥,这意味着如果私钥被盗,所有资产都将面临风险。而多重签名钱包则需要多个私钥的共同参与才能完成交易,这有效地妨碍了单一攻击行为的成功。
具体来说,普通钱包的流程非常简单,用户只需输入自己的私钥即可完成转账。而多重签名钱包在转账时则需要多个密钥的签名,流程相对复杂,但安全性却更加可靠。此外,对于企业或团队管理而言,多重签名的钱包可以设计不同的决策流程,以符合组织的需求,从而避免管理混乱。
8. 多重签名技术的潜在风险是什么?
虽然多重签名显著提高了钱包的安全性,但其自身也存在一些潜在风险:
- 密钥管理:如果失去了某个密钥,可能会导致无法进行交易。例如,在2/3的配置中,如果有一个密钥遗失,那么就无法完成交易。
- 操作复杂性:与普通钱包相比,多重签名的设置和操作流程相对复杂,新用户可能需要时间来适应并学习。
- 第三方服务信任:有些用户可能会选择依赖第三方服务生成多重签名钱包,这可能会引入信任问题。
9. 如何选择合适的多重签名钱包?
选择合适的多重签名钱包需要考虑多个因素:
- 安全性:优先选择提供高安全性措施的钱包,比如支持硬件钱包。
- 用户友好性:新手用户应选择用户界面简单易用的钱包,以便快速上手。
- 社区支持:选择那些有良好社区支持和活跃开发者的 wallets,这能确保未来更新和安全补丁的推出。
10. 未来多重签名技术的发展趋势是什么?
未来的多重签名技术将会朝着更安全、更便利和更灵活的方向发展。
- 智能合约的集成:未来的多重签名钱包可能会与区块链智能合约更好地集成,实现自动化的审批和决策过程。
- 用户界面改善:为了吸引更多用户,钱包开发者可能会更加注重用户体验,使得复杂的多重签名操作变得简单直观。
- 扩展应用场景:多重签名钱包将不仅限于比特币,还将扩展到其他加密资产,为不同领域的资金管理提供解决方案。
结论
综上所述,比特币钱包中的多重签名技术无疑是提升加密货币安全性的重要手段。通过多个密钥的共用管理,用户可以有效地保护他们的资产,并且在团队或企业环境中实现更为合理的资金管理方式。虽然这一技术仍有其挑战与潜在风险,但随着技术的不断进步和用户体验的,它在未来必将发挥更大作用,让更多的人受益。